Heritage organisations have been urged to check their risk management strategies as cost of living pressures could drive more smash and grab attacks in the new year.

data thief hacker

Speaking to Insurance Times, Faith Kitchen, customer segment director at Ecclesiastical Insurance, said such firms needed to be aware of the crime and that now was a “good window of opportunity” to look at how they can best protect irreplaceable items.

A smash and grab raid is carried out at speed, using extreme force to break through physical barriers to gain access to a property.

In instances involving heritage organisations, such as museums, theatres and galleries, burglaries are often pre-planned to target high value items.

Kitchen warned that such firms were “an attractive target for these crimes”.

“We have been raising the awareness [of these attacks] because of the speed it is carried out and the extreme force the thieves use to overcome physical barriers to gain access,” she said.

“Museums need to be aware of the risk when it comes to smash and grab attacks as they have been increasing over the past few years.
